Abstract

Objective To investigate the value of 18F-FETNIM micro PET /CT in assessing the radiotherapeutic efficacy in MDA-MB231 breast cancer model. Methods Sixteen MDA-MB231 breast cancer models were randomly diveded into two groups(8 rats in each group):control group(group A) and radiotherapy group(group B). 18 FFETNIM micro PET /CT imaging was performed in two groups to measure the SUVmax of tumor in all nude mice. The morphological features of tumor tissue in each group were observed by HE staining. The expression of hypoxia inducible factor 1α(HIF-1α) in two groups were determined by immunohistochemistry. Results There was no significant difference in the SUVmax value between control group and radiotherapy group before radiotherapy (t = 0. 375,P > 0. 05). The SUVmax value of tumor tissue when 48 h after radiotherapy was significantly lower than that before radiotherapy (t = 9. 958,P < 0. 05) and 24 h after radiotherapy(t = 16. 506,P < 0. 05),the difference was statistically significant(F = 58. 860,P < 0. 05). The SUVmax value of tumor tissue when 48 h after radiotherapy was also lower than before radiotherapy(t = 5. 405,P < 0. 05). More obvious necrosis was observed in the radiotherapy group than the control group by HE staining. The expressions of HIF-1α in the radiotherapy group were significantly decreased compared with the control group(t = 14. 802,P < 0. 05). The tumor SUVmax value was positively correlated with HIF-1α expression(r = 0. 865,P < 0. 05). Conclusion 18F-FETNIM micro PET /CT not only can be used to detect the hypoxic state within the tumor,but also can evaluate the early radiotherapeutic efficacy in MDA-MB231 breast cancer in nude mice.
